Thursday was pretty uneventful although I had a friend from St. Louis send me links to the youtube posting from 1991 and the infamous Guns n Roses riot. I look back and think...I was there...
I will never forget this show. It was also the FIRST of many riots to come by Axl Rose and his band mates. When we were at the show we didn't realize how crazy and dangerous the scene really was. As I look back watching the video footage I think...holy sh*t. What a crazy scene. Watch it for yourself. Some of the footage is hard to see because of the black and white film but you will get the idea of how insane it was and the destruction left behind.

I remember coming home and my family was freaking out. After watching the footage I can see why. I do remember the next day going to work and half of my co-workers were surprised that I had made it in since they saw the footage on the national news. Up to that point of the show it was awesome. This is one of the reasons why I think Axl is a great front man...not because he can start a riot but because you just never know what that dude is going to do.
